Greedy Heirs Tried to Earn Favor with Grandpa to Inherit More — Their Jaws Dropped When the Lawyer Read the Will

Mr. Lewis, an 83-year-old man who had built a life of hard work and generosity, found himself reflecting on the emptiness of his family’s attention during his final days. He had raised eight children—four biological and four adopted—and had always been a pillar of kindness, opening his home to foster children and donating generously to charity. However, as he grew older, he noticed that his children and grandchildren only visited him when they needed something, treating him more like a bank than a loved one.

When Mr. Lewis received a terminal diagnosis, he shared the news with his family. Within hours, they gathered around him, but their concern felt hollow. They hovered, offering to help but only out of a desire to secure their inheritance. Mr. Lewis, seeing through their charade, decided to take a different path with his wealth.

When Mr. Lewis passed away, his family gathered eagerly for the reading of his will, expecting to receive their share of his fortune. However, they were shocked when the family lawyer introduced a 13-year-old girl named Harper, who had been included in the will reading.

Harper was not a member of the family but was a neighbor who had befriended Mr. Lewis during his final years. Unlike his own children and grandchildren, Harper visited Mr. Lewis daily, offering him companionship without expecting anything in return. She made him feel less lonely during a time when his own family had become distant.

The lawyer revealed that Mr. Lewis had left his entire fortune to Harper, a decision he explained in a letter to his family. In the letter, Mr. Lewis shared how Harper’s kindness had been a light in his life. He also revealed that Harper was battling a terminal illness and that he wanted to ensure she could live her remaining time to the fullest.

The news left Mr. Lewis’s children and grandchildren stunned and ashamed. Harper, though surprised by the inheritance, made it clear that she never wanted Mr. Lewis’s money—only his friendship. She planned to use the money to travel with her parents and enjoy the time she had left, and any remaining funds would go to help other children like her.

In the months that followed, Harper fulfilled her dreams, creating precious memories with her parents before she passed away peacefully. Her remaining inheritance was donated to children’s cancer charities, funding research and supporting families in need.

Harper’s legacy of kindness and courage left a lasting impact on Mr. Lewis’s family. They realized that the true value of life and love was far greater than any amount of money. Through Harper’s example, they learned the importance of genuine connections and the profound impact that a single act of kindness can have.
